    do better market research. pull 1000+ keywords on your niche. Take a really close look at what is really selling in that market. Visit many other sites in that niche. Contact some of the people selling in that niche to find out what is really selling.

    Present a unique point of view in that market with the types of products that you know are selling well.

    Can't emphasize enough the lesson you've probably heard on the forums here many times: pick something and get to work. Pick a niche, grab a bunch of keywords and just start writing. Then write some more. Then keep writing. Don't worry if you don't get a sale right away. Keep going.

    Find the thread about Tiffany's 30 day article writing challenge and join in. Post at least one article every single day, more if you have a lot of time. Don't worry about the results, just keep doing it. The #1 newbie mistake is to dabble. Don't dabble. Jump in and keep going for 30 days. Then you can check your results.
